Kraken and SoFi Link Crypto Trading To Banking Rails

Kraken and SoFi have announced a partnership that will integrate cryptocurrency trading into traditional banking services. This new deal, revealed on October 23, 2023, aims to streamline the connection between crypto assets and mainstream banking, allowing users to manage both more seamlessly. The integration comes after SoFi launched its bitcoin trading feature last year, signaling a growing interest in digital assets among traditional financial institutions.

The collaboration is part of a broader trend where fintech companies are increasingly incorporating cryptocurrency services to meet the rising demand from consumers. As digital currencies gain popularity, many financial institutions see the potential for growth in this sector. By linking Kraken's cryptocurrency trading platform with SoFi's banking services, the two companies hope to attract a wider customer base that wants to engage with both fiat and crypto assets in one place. This move reflects a significant shift in the financial landscape, where barriers between traditional banking and digital currencies are gradually breaking down.

In practical terms, this partnership means that SoFi customers will have greater access to various cryptocurrencies and can execute trades without needing to use multiple platforms. SoFi's 5.5 million members will now find it easier to invest in digital assets alongside their conventional banking activities. This could also lead to increased transaction volumes for Kraken, which already serves millions of users worldwide. The integration is expected to enhance user experience, simplify payments, and promote the growth of digital asset markets.

Looking ahead, this partnership may pave the way for further collaborations between crypto exchanges and traditional banks. As regulatory frameworks around cryptocurrencies become clearer, more financial institutions might seek to offer integrated services. The success of this collaboration could influence how quickly mainstream adoption of cryptocurrencies occurs, potentially reshaping the financial ecosystem. With both companies poised to benefit, the implications of this partnership extend beyond individual users, potentially impacting the future of finance as a whole.
